Hunting a playoff berth, general manager Jason Licht was roster shuffling today.

The Bucs cut injured wide receiver Louis Murphy, whose November 2015 ACL surgery comeback was marred by a setback last month.

Running back Mike James also got the boot. With Jacquizz Rodgers now ready to roll, and Charles Sims absolutely returning next week, James became expendable. Sad times at JoeBucsFan.com world headquarters. Joe is a big James fan.

With Chris Conte banged up against the Seahawks– official injury update Wednesday afternoon — the Bucs signed safety Major Wright, who was here under the Lovie Smith regime and hung around for most of training camp this season before heading home to his couch.

Wright stunned everyone early in training camp with his ludicrous head shot on teammate Brandon Myers.

Joe sees Wright as purely an emergency signing, a veteran familiar with the defense and one the team can trust in the locker room.
